Sava Villas on Natai Beach have the most idyllic scenery. The Sava Villas make a great base to explore Phang Nga on a catamaran, particularly if you want to visit James Bond Island, which was made famous by Roger Moore in The Man With The Golden Gun.
Villa Tievoli - This is the biggest unit in the estate. It has a cute kids’ room complete with a slide bunk bed. Staying in Phang Nga means that during nesting season, kids will have the opportunity to learn about conservation by participating in sea turtle excursions, including night walks and dawn patrol in Mai Khao. Here families can scour the beach for nests and hatchlings and make sure they are safe from predators. Villa Tievoli, www.zekkeicollection.com/en/property/tievoli

Ban Mekkala - The villa offers a stretch of secluded beach and exciting water sports options. Ban Mekkala has kayaks and paddleboards in the house. Fishing, sailing and hobbie cats can be arranged. All six en-suite bedrooms are located on the ground floor around a big lawn, the pool and dining sala - a beautiful under-the-stars dining area. This is well laid out for a big group to socialize, and also to retreat to their private sleeping space with ease throughout the day. The pool at 25m is big enough for laps, and you can enjoy this all to yourself! Ban Mekkala, www.zekkeicollection.com/en/property/mekkala/

The Longhouse - The Longhouse clings dramatically to a hilltop in Jimbaran, with panoramic views stretching over the south coast of Bali. This is the best spot to enjoy magical sunsets. A children’s play area is equipped with toys, books and games. The kids facilities include a baby cot, high chair, car seat and pool fence - on request. It is designed with families in mind to entertain guests of all ages. All six en-suite bedrooms have their own spacious outdoor terrace. With a home cinema, spa room, 12-seater teak dining table and ample lounge space, all make the villa perfect for groups and extended families.
